Representations have been received from Trade bodies that field formations are not promptly sanctioning the rebate claims due to them. A suggestion has been made that the time limit prescribed in Section 11BB of the Central Excise Act, 1944 may be reduced from 3 months to 30 days.
The Item Vinylidene Chloride is the Monomer and Polyvinylidene Chloride is the Polymer of Vinylidene Chloride. The Polyvinylidene Chloride Polymer is to be used for the coating of PVC Film in the manufacturing process and is the correct nomenclature of the import item. That is why this amendment was necessitated.

The Government of Maharashtra amended the Maharashtra State Tax on Professions, Trades, Callings and Employments Rules, 1975 (PT Rules) vide above referred notification making it mandatory for the new and all the existing Profession Tax Payers to communicate their income tax PAN or TAN or both, as the case may be, to the Department.
When the goods deposited in a warehouse remain warehoused beyond a period of ninety days, then the interest starts accruing. In other words, the relevant date when the period of 90 days would commence would be the date of depositing the goods in the warehouse.
